Behavioral Health Works is a rapidly expanding company committed to delivering personalized ABA therapy for children and adolescents diagnosed with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D). ABA therapy helps individuals with Autism improve socially significant behavior, following the principles of Behavior Analysis. Our extensively trained BCBAs and R / BTs collaborate closely with parents to create tailored treatment plans that address the distinct requirements of each child.
